Do you know which task/object NETPTH tries to talk to? Obviously MIM 
don't have one running, but depending on what, it might be something 
that I just have not set up. Is NML the object? What is NML?

It sends the same requests that you would send to a another node using NCP
to ask for example about the known circuits.
